An interview with Lyall Lupin
What is your real, birth name? What name do you use? Lyall Lloyd Lupin... don’t know what my parents were thinking really. I never use Lloyd, it’s just Lyall Lupin.
Do you have a nickname? What is it, and where did you get it? Mostly people just call me Ly... I think that’s pretty self explanatory, right? What do you look like? What kinda weird question is this, you’re looking right at me aren’t you? What? The way I see myself? Uh. I’m pretty tall, I think lanky is the word I’m looking for. My hair looks like it was once blonde and I forgot to wash it. Come to think of it, I haven’t washed it in a while. It’s long but not long enough yet. My eyes are blue. I’ve got a bit of facial hair now. Not much though. How do you dress most of the time? Well, most of the time I have to wear my school robes. They are rather boring. The professors make me wear shoes, which is annoying. But, they are long enough and cover up enough that I don’t have to wear underpants, so I guess it’s a fair trade off. How do you "dress up?" Depends on the occasion, doesn’t it? I’ve got a suit floating about somewhere, not all that fond of wearing it though, very restrictive. I like dressing up in nice skirts, pretty silk ones are my favourite, but they are ridiculously expensive. I have a very nice fur coat for when it’s cold. If I’m dressing up I like doing my make up too, I’ve gotten pretty good at it too. Jewellery too, I really like to pile my jewellery on. I like the way it sparkles and clinks together. And always a flower crown, can’t go out without one of those. How do you "dress down?" When I have nowhere to be I will wear precisely nothing. Old pairs of trousers, or loose skirts. Tshirts or vests or jumpers if it gets cold. If I’m not trying to look good I probably look rather terrible. What do you wear when you go to sleep? I hate to sound like a scratched record, but once again, precisely nothing. Pajamas ride up all over the place and are so incredibly uncomfortable. I can’t sleep if I am wearing anything. In your opinion, what is your best feature? I really don’t know. Ask Xaldin or someone. Oh, my opinion? I don’t know. I guess I rather like my smile. What's your real birth date? June 10, ‘26 Where do you live? Describe it: I guess I live in two places, d’ya wanna hear about them both? Okay my room at school is always a bit of a mess. My beds four poster, I’m not sure if I’m allowed to but I’ve been practicing my stitching all over my curtains, so they are decorated with all sorts of fabric scraps and funny looking flowers. All the walls ‘round my bed are covered in photographs I’ve taken. I’m greedy and always keep my favourites. I’ve got a few jugs of flowers by my bed but I don’t change ‘em as much as I should. My other house is the farm. The farm is big, it’s a dairy farm, so lots of cows and cow sheds and stuff. The house is small and it really needs fixing up. The roof of my bedroom was leaking last time I went home but I patched it up. My bedroom at home is also covered in lots of photos, I’m actually running out of room on the walls their. Round the skirting it all these pictures me and my sister used to draw. Oh and mam would always measure my height on my bedroom door... even now she makes me do it every summer I’m home. Do you own a car? Describe it. No I don’t have a car. I’ve got a motorcycle though. I’m not sure if I own it technically. It’s my dads. But it was all rusting in the shed when I found it two years ago. He hadn’t rode it since Finch was born. So I think it’s mine. It’s a Triumph 6/1. I’m not sure what the 6/1 means. It rides like an absolute beast. I love it. What is your most prized possession? Why do you value it so much? My cameras. Don’t even ask me to choose a favourite between ‘em all. I love being able to capture all these memories and moments on film. It’s really exciting. My camera feel like an extension of myself, half the time things only look normal through a lens for me. I get to know people so much better when I photograph them. You see a different side to people.
What one word best describes you? I dunno... Lyall, I guess. My name just about sums me up I think. What is your family like? My family are really brilliant. We all get along just great, they are funny and creative and accepting. They accepted my differences when they found out I’m a wizard. Wasn’t even too shocked. They are work far too hard. ‘Specially mam. She works on the farm all day, and raises the kids and runs the house all on her own. I miss them a lot. Who is your father, and what is he like? Conall Lupin. He’s a bit wild. Travelled ‘round a lot and finally settled down in Wales when he met mam. Always doing weird things like pulling coins out from our ears, said it was magic, if you’d believe it! Never really took to farm life I don’t think. He’s in the war now. Probably getting a kick out of the excitement if you ask me. I worry though, in almost every letter mam sends she tells me about another neighbour dying or going missing. I hope it doesn’t happen to him. Who is your mother, and what is she like? Nerys Broderick. She grew up on this farm, took it over when she married dad. She’s the best cook in the world I think. She’s gentle but... she means business. All the time. When mam says do something it gets done. Even dad’d listen to her when she gets serious. I’m not too sure if she ever sleeps, she is always so busy. Never stops smiling though, even when she is mad as all hell she will still find a reason to smile and laugh. What is your parents marriage like? They’d row like cats and dogs at least once a week. Dad’d smash plates and storm off in a huff. Mam’d laugh, then follow him, then they’d come back holding hands and laughing, usually with bits of hay stuck in their hair. I never really got that, maybe they went out to the barn and had a hay fight until they made up. They love each other though, despite the rows and how different they are. It is quite lovely. Mam worries herself sick about dad though she will never admit it. What are your siblings names? What are they like? Rhian is the oldest. She’s 18 and I’m rather fond of her. We always got along really well growing up. Now she sends me Vogue magazines, and I send her Witch Weekly. It’s a good trade if you ask me. Aidan and Imogen are twins. They are 11 now. Immy cried when she didn’t get a Hogwarts letter, and laughed at Aidan for not getting one too. She bullies him a fair bit, but will have a fit if any of us so much as tease him. She takes great pride in being the older twin. Aidan is much quieter than her, maybe the quietest of our whole family, he reads a lot. Finch is the baby, well not anymore I guess, he’s six now. Really enjoys being out of the farm, he is already milking cows even though he can barely reach the udders. I think everyone is keeping a close eye on him, I was about his age when I started showing signs of my magic. I kinda hope he does follow in my footsteps, it’d be real nice to be able to share this with someone in my family. How old were you when you went on your first date? Well this is a bit embarrassing, but I’ve never actually been on a date. I might be the only one in my year who hasn’t. Wanna know something funny? I was supposed to go on a date last weekend, but obviously couldn’t do that. We will try again though, so I will be sixteen when I go on my first date. What annoys you more than anything else? More than anything? Gosh. Probably people who always correct my grammar. All the time. It’s so silly, if people can understand what I’m saying, what does it matter how the words come out? What would be the perfect gift for you? Unlimited reels of film. Colour film. A video camera. A boat or a plane to travel the world. All that would be perfect. What's the most beautiful thing you've ever seen? Thing, not person? Are you sure I can’t choose a person? Okay. Backstage. It’s beautiful, always. And that’s all I can say. What time of day is your favorite? The hour leading up to sunrise, and sunrise itself. The sky looks beautiful and all the colours are just right. The air is always so still, it’s the only time I really feel calm. What kind of weather is your favorite? I love storms. Lots of thunder and lightning. I used to always run outside in thunder storms and jump in the puddles and try take photographs of the lightning. What is your favorite food? What is your least favorite food? Figs, fresh figs. They are juicy and sweet and the seeds feel like they are popping when you bite into them. It’s incredible. I also really love cheese. Like, a lot. D’ya know what is really good, figs and goats cheese. But you’ve gotta drizzle it in honey too. Honest! Least favourite. I don’t much like potatoes, unless they are roasted. They just taste so bland. And porridge, oh I hate porridge, it’s like eating flavourless mud. What's the worst thing that can be done to another person? Why? Definitely killing them. What could be worse than that? Or maybe killing someone they love, right in front of them. Death is so final, once you are dead you can’t live anymore, y’know? And since life is the best thing, death must be the worst.
What's the worst thing you could actually do to someone you hated? Me, personally? I’m not sure if I have ever hated someone. I dunno. I don’t like this question, do I have to answer it? Uh. I ‘spose I could poison someone, not enough to kill them! Just to make them a bit sick. Maybe? I dunno. I don’t like thinking about this.
Is it okay for you to cry? When was the last time you cried? Yeah, ‘course. Sometimes you just gotta cry. Last time I cried? Not long ago actually. I’m not saying why. It’s personal. What do you do when you are bored? Develop photographs. I take ‘em faster than I can develop ‘em so I always have rolls and rolls waiting to be developed. It’s a good way to spend a few hours and I always entertain myself looking back over the pictures. It’s funny how much stuff I forget until I am looking right at it again. Or sometimes I like to put on make up, just try out new stuff, make myself look pretty. It’s good to practice as much as I can. Then sometimes I take photographs of it. Then go develop them.
